Product-led growth has become a popular go-to-market strategy in the digital age. In its superlative form, everything a company does from marketing, sales, operations, development and support is driven by and through the product. The goals are to make products easier to acquire, onboard, use and achieve quick time to value. The product-led growth market strategy revolves around the user and is best geared toward engaging with smaller accounts rather than large enterprise companies.

SAN FRANCISCO — November 10, 2020 — InfluxData, creator of the time series database InfluxDB, today announced the general availability of the next-generation open source platform for time series data, InfluxDB 2.0. Developers can now ingest, query, store and visualize time series data in a single unified platform, leverage new tools and integrations, and use familiar skills — making it faster and easier than ever to develop and deploy modern time-based applications.
